BACKGROUND TO GLMCC:

Green Lane Masjid and Community Centre is a leading UK mosque situated in the heart of Birmingham serving the community since 1979. Operating from its award-winning grade II listed Victorian building, GLMCC fulfils its mission of inspiring, educating and serving through its educational college, outreach work, welfare services, youth work, international humanitarian wing, as well as its fully functional mosque which is attended by thousands every week.

1. PURPOSE OF THE ROLE:

The Fundraising Manager will play a crucial role in sustaining the current fundraising income of the organisation, covering both its humanitarian arm (Taskforce GLM) and Green Lane Masjid. This role involves end-to-end campaign management on a monthly basis for both entities, including devising campaign calendars, setting up emergency campaigns, brainstorming and executing new fundraising ideas, and managing event planning and execution. The Fundraising Manager will oversee new campaign management, major donor relationship building, writing grant funding applications to increase organisational revenue. They will support the Head of Fundraising with new initiatives for income growth and secure/strengthen relationships with large donors.

2. MAIN RESPONSIBILITIES FOR THE ROLE

• Sustain current fundraising income for both Taskforce GLM and Green Lane Masjid. • End-to-end campaign management monthly for both entities, including campaign calendar development and emergency campaign setup. • Brainstorm and execute new fundraising event ideas, liaising with relevant stakeholders. • Manage new campaign management monthly, including collaboration with videography, website development, and design teams. • Maximise opportunities for Jumu'ah collections and footfall engagement. • Plan and execute four dinners annually for various campaigns. • Deliver fundraising pitches and apply for grant funding to increase organisational revenue. • Support the Head of Fundraising with new income growth initiatives. • Secure and strengthen relationships with large donors to generate additional revenue streams. .
